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0655955664 27426 57 829
5393358561 7243 971984204
5393358561 7243 971984204
84899245768 27 90382346 18082 70
All about undefined
Interested in learning more?
5393358561 7243 971984204
84899245768 27 90382346 18082 70
See more
71 663
66220 853 6963153
See more
4904 73622453 28100
03 2839908 6971 045180 635100931
See more